The author describes a concerning experience where an AI model, likely influenced by a "harness" layer, unexpectedly suggested integrations with Microsoft 365 and Zapier without explicit user request. This harness, acting as an opaque intermediary, injects vendor instructions alongside user prompts, making it unclear which instructions originate from the user versus the AI provider.
